For buyers contracting authority
Reach for 48824000 when the print-management layer is the point of the contract: the server, the queues, the driver and access control that sit in front of an organisation's printers. It is the right tag when print infrastructure is procured in its own right rather than as a line item under a general server deal.
The boundary that trips authorities runs two ways. Up the tree, a contract for general-purpose servers belongs under Computer servers (48822000) or the parent Servers (48820000), not here. Sideways, the printers and copiers themselves are separate hardware codes, so a tender whose substance is buying devices, not managing them, sits elsewhere.
Real usage is looser than the label. Notices under this code wrap the print server into a wider managed-print arrangement covering a fleet. If print management is the main purpose, keeping the bundle here is defensible; set the primary CPV code by the dominant deliverable when devices and management are mixed.
